Frank Sinatra, Doris Day. Originally released as a motion picture in 1954.
Summary:
Young at Heart is centered on a family headed by a music-loving patriarch and his musically inclined daughters looking for romance. Doris Day plays the youngest daughter. Laurie, and Gig Young plays Alex Burke, a likable composer who comes for an extended visit and eventually wins the hearts of all three sisters. Frank Sinatra plays Barney Sloan, a cynical songwriter hired by Alex to do arrangements for an upcoming Broadway show.
